China Satellite Communications Co., Ltd. Overview
Pro stress-test →China Satellite Communications Co., Ltd. is a comprehensive satellite communications and broadcasting services provider serving broadcast, telecom, corporate, and government customers. Founded in 2001 and headquartered in Beijing, the company operates as a subsidiary of China Aerospace Science and Technology Corporation, positioning it as a strategic player in China's satellite infrastructure ecosystem.
Strategic Profile
Pro stress-test →The company maintains a diversified portfolio spanning satellite resource leasing, bandwidth rental, equipment supply, system integration, and value-added information services. Its competitive strength derives from government backing, integrated service capabilities across telecommunications, remote sensing, IoT, emergency communications, and aviation services, and deep expertise in satellite-based broadband solutions for enterprises.
